With interest rates near zero these ASX income shares are in focus – Motley Fool Australia
The RBA’s decision to cut the official cash rate to a razor thin 0.1% puts ASX dividend paying shares in the spotlight.
There were three big events I, and most Aussies, had a close eye on yesterday.
We’re still awaiting the definitive outcome of the United States elections. Both the White House and the Senate can potentially go to Joe Biden and the Democrats, or Donald Trump and the Republicans.
We do know that Twilight Payment, ridden by Jye McNeil, took first place at the Melbourne Cup.
And, of far more significance to Australia’s savers, we know that the Reserve Bank of Australia (RBA) cut the official cash rate,…
